Understanding Las Vegas Travel Seasons

Las Vegas is a year-round destination,Uncovering Affordable Airfare to Las Vegas Articles but its peak travel periods typically fall during the winter and autumn months. The city's cooler temperatures during these seasons make it an ideal time for tourists to explore the Strip and beyond. Additionally, Las Vegas is a hot spot for ringing in the New Year, with flights filling up fast for New Year's Eve celebrations. It's also a hub for major business conferences, which can significantly impact flight and hotel prices.

According to the Las Vegas Convention and Visitors Authority, the city hosted over 5 million convention attendees in 2019. Events like the Consumer Electronics Show (CES) can draw crowds of over 170,000 participants, leading to a surge in travel costs (LVCVA).

Peak Season Travel Tips

  • Book Early: Secure your flights well in advance to avoid inflated prices.
  • Stay Informed: Check the Las Vegas convention calendar to avoid dates with large events.
  • Be Flexible: Consider flying on weekdays rather than weekends when fares are often lower.

The Off-Season Advantage

Traveling to Las Vegas during the summer months can offer significant savings. Despite the scorching heat, the city's world-class indoor amenities, such as air-conditioned hotels and casinos, provide a cool escape. During this off-season, you'll find a plethora of promotional deals, not only on accommodations but also on entertainment and dining.

Summer Savings Strategies

  • Look for Promotions: Hotels and casinos often offer discounted rates and packages.
  • Enjoy Fewer Crowds: With fewer tourists, you can experience more of what Las Vegas has to offer without the wait.
  • Save on Flights: Airlines are more likely to offer lower fares to attract travelers during the slower summer months.

Smart Booking Tactics

Even if you must travel during the busier times, there are ways to keep costs down. Opting for a red-eye flight can result in cheaper tickets, and you might appreciate the quiet time to rest after experiencing Vegas's non-stop energy.

Money-Saving Booking Tips

  • Red-Eye Flights: These late-night flights can be less expensive and less crowded.
  • Price Drop Policies: Some airlines offer refunds or credits if the fare drops after you book. Keep an eye on prices and don't hesitate to contact the airline if you notice a decrease.

Leveraging Airline Policies

Airlines are keen to maintain customer loyalty, and many have policies in place to accommodate passengers who find their flight has decreased in price after booking. If you spot a lower fare for the same flight, reach out to the airline. They may offer reimbursement, vouchers, or future discounts to ensure your continued patronage.

How to Claim Fare Differences

  • Monitor Fares: After booking, continue to check prices for your flight.
  • Contact the Airline: If you see a lower price, call the airline's customer service to inquire about their price drop policy.
  • Be Persistent: Airlines may not advertise this policy widely, so it's important to advocate for yourself.
